Where Estate Planners in Grimes, IA Serve

Grimes, IA is a vibrant city located in Polk County, Iowa. The city is home to several landmarks that showcase its rich history and culture. These landmarks include the Grimes Community Complex, the Grimes Public Library, and the Grimes Sports Complex. Grimes is also known for its top employers, including Hy-Vee, Walmart, and Fareway Stores. The city is conveniently located near several major highways and streets, including Interstate 35, Highway 141, and Highway 44. Grimes is divided into several neighborhoods, each with its own unique charm and character. These neighborhoods include the Autumn Park, Beaverbrooke, and Chevalia Valley Estates. With its bustling economy, rich history, and diverse neighborhoods, Grimes is a great place to live, work, and play.
